RE: Notice of Violation of International Property Maintenance Codes,Chapter 3,Section 307.1 —Accumulation of
Rubbish and Garbage and Chapter 3,Section 302.8—Motor Vehicles at property known as:2113 Fairway Villas
Lane,Atlantic Beach,39-22 08-2S-29E Fairway Villas,RE# 169398-1038
Dear Mr.Colston;
Please be advised,Atlantic Beach Code Enforcement has found the property at the above referenced address to be in
violation of the following codes:Chapter 3,Section 307.1—Accumulation of rubbish and garbage which states"All
exterior property and premises,and the interior of every structure,shall be free from any accumulation of rubbish or
garbage"and Chapter 3,Section 302.8—Motor Vehicles which states"Except as provided for in other regulations,no
inoperative or unlicensed motor vehicle shall be parked,kept or stored on any premises,and no vehicle shall at any time
be in a state of major disassembly,disrepair,or in the process of being stripped or dismantled."
This letter requests the noted violations be corrected by removing all the auto parts and debris from the front yard
and licensing or removing the inoperable vehicle from the property within ten days from receipt of this letter. If the
violations are corrected and then recurs or if the violations are not corrected by the time specified in this notice this case
may be presented to the Atlantic Beach Code Enforcement Board even if the violations have been corrected prior to the
board meeting.The Code Enforcement Board may impose fines up to$250 a day for each day the violation is not
corrected.
A re-inspection will be done on/or after June 24,2010. To avoid having this Code Enforcement case set for hearing,
all listed violation(s)on this notice must be in compliance on or before the date established by Atlantic Beach Code
Enforcement.Upon completing the corrective action(s)required,it is your responsibility to contact Atlantic Beach Code
Enforcement and arrange for an inspection to verify compliance.
It is our goal to enforce the codes and ordinances of the City of Atlantic Beach and protect the health,safety and
welfare of the City,and accordingly,your cooperation in this matter is greatly appreciated.Please contact Atlantic
Beach Code Enforcement at 904-247-5826 if you have any questions or need additional information.
